CSCS TXThe Facilities Maintenance Coordinator is responsible for dispatching all inbound work orders for assigned areas, managing repair and maintenance work orders from start to finish for assigned categories. This role works with vendors and internal teams to make sure repairs are completed on time, updates are communicated, and processes are followed.
Key Responsibilities
· Review all incoming work orders for your assigned areas and check if they can be dispatched, considering factors like financial responsibility under the lease, warranty coverage, business programs, and urgency.
· Utilize problem solving skills to identify and respond appropriately to issues.
· Dispatch and coordinate vendors; confirm scope, ETA, and follow-through in a timely manner.
· Manage and prioritize work orders from creation to completion for assigned categories.
· Communicate status, delays, and escalations to internal teams and field partners.
· Monitor open work and drive timely resolution.
